Understanding the Hemodialysis Machine

A hemodialysis machine is a sophisticated medical device that mimics the function of healthy kidneys by filtering waste products and excess fluids from a patient’s blood. Organ-on-Chip Models: A New Frontier in Biomedical Research

Organ-on-chip models are at the forefront of biomedical research, offering a groundbreaking approach to studying human organ functions in a controlled, lab-based environment. These models are small, microengineered devices that replicate the complex physiology of human organs by combining living cells with microfluidic channels. Understanding Pharmaceutical Filters: Essential Components in Drug Manufacturing

Pharmaceutical filters play a crucial role in the drug manufacturing process, ensuring the purity, safety, and quality of pharmaceutical products. These specialized filters are designed to remove contaminants, such as particulates, bacteria, and other impurities, from liquids, gases, and air used in the production of medications.
